from collections import defaultdict
T=int(input())
for tt in range(T):
N=int(input())
ss=input()
ans=0
ll=[-999999 for nn in range(N)]
rr=[9999999 for nn in range(N)]
if ss[0]=='1':
ll[0]=0
for nn in range(1,N):
if ss[nn]=='0':
ll[nn]=ll[nn-1]
else:
ll[nn]=nn
if ss[N-1]=='1':
rr[N-1]=N-1
for nn in range(N-2,-1,-1):
if ss[nn]=='0':
rr[nn]=rr[nn+1]
else:
rr[nn]=nn
for nn in range(N):
ans+=min(nn-ll[nn],rr[nn]-nn)
print('Case #%d: %d' % (tt+1, ans))



